Hello,
I have made it all the way up to the Download Private Key prompt. Once I download it, the prompt doesn't go away, and if i click the x to close the prompt it sets the encryption setting to no.
If I may be doing anything wrong, please feel free to mention it.
Thank You
-
MarvihReplied on October 19, 2017 at 3:17 PM
Try setting it to "Yes" again then proceed entering your password. If it says "you already have saved a public key", select "I will use my existing key".
That is the key you have already downloaded and will be use to unlock your encryption.
